ATTENTION INVESTORS - THIS PROPERTY IS CURRENTLY TENANTED ACHEIVING £8340 RENT PER ANNUMBehrens Warehouse was originally one of the largest of the warehouse/office blocks in the area known as LittleGermany. It was originally designed for S L Behrens in1873 by the Milnes and France partnership, and was re developed into residential apartments in 2003. Ingle Court is ideally placed for the centre of Market Weighton and local amenities.Market Weighton - Market Weighton is a growing, increasingly popular market town situated on the edge of the Yorkshire Wolds overlooking the Vale of York and is central for York, Hull, Beverley and the M62 motorway. The towns ample amenities include schools, churches, doctors' surgery, dental surgeries, public houses, high street shops, bank and supermarkets, one with a filling station. Sports and leisure facilities are well catered for with a sports centre, gymnasium, bowling green, tennis courts and nearby golf and polo clubs.
